All hail the almighty dollar?Well how it's supposed to work is called Quantitative Tightening. Which is pretty much the opposite of Quantitative Easing (duh),
What it really means is that instead of "creating" more money then issuing said money as bonds the Fed instead "deletes" the money after the bond is matured (paid off) rather then reissuing the funds in another bond.
So that's the plan to ease inflation, raising the interest rates to cool spending is part of it though but not a big part. Too much "cooling" and you start a recession spiral and bad things start to happen. The idea is too slowly, ever so slowly, dry up the money well this forcing banks to be more careful when issuing loans as they must pay the Fed more per bond they buy. So people will get less money in loans, forcing less spending and thus lowering inflation as prices will have to match available funds with more competition between sellers.
